
Grace Eyre has a team of superheroes taking on the London to Brighton Cycle Ride this Sunday 10th September 2023 to raise money for Grace Eyre.
The 55-mile trip starts at Clapham Common in London and ends on Madeira Drive in Brighton.
Every pound raised will go towards providing projects and services that enrich and enhance the lives of adults with learning disabilities and autism in our local communities.

Come and cheer them across the finish line
It would be wonderful if we can get lots of people from Grace Eyre down to cheer our cyclists over the line. They will have just cycled 55 miles – including the uphill monster that is Ditchling Beacon – so they deserve a hero’s welcome!
It is going to be great day with a fantastic atmosphere, and it would be brilliant to see lots of people there.
The finish line is on Madeira Drive on Brighton seafront. Super speedy riders will start arriving at about 9:00 am. Most of the riders are expected to arrive between 12:00 noon and 3:30 pm.
We will have a Grace Eyre stall in the dedicated charity area at the finish line so come and say hi!
